# Nampa - FLIRT for (binary) ninjas
*Pure-python implementation of IDA Pro's FLIRT technology. Also Binary Ninja plugin.*
## Description
Nampa is a package for reading IDA Pro's `.sig` files.
It comes with its own command-line tool for analyzing such files: `dumpsig.py`.
Nampa the package is completely decoupled from the Binary Ninja plugin.
Nampa the plugin comes with a small library of `.sig` files, automatically
downloaded from 3rd-party GitHub repositories when needed.

## Installation
For use as a python library:
```bash
pip install nampa
```
For use as a Binary Ninja plugin:
```bash
cd ~/.binaryninja/plugins/
git clone git@github.com:thebabush/nampa.git
cd nampa
```
**NOTE:** apparently, Binary Ninja for Windows ships with its own python distribution so `pip install` accordingly.
